Output 997c64ae60270b383833851e65a4b791be0bd73832764217ce11802174a2674d:2

value
23966233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06831b2b9d2173d0197353612a2beae7f303d462 OP_EQUAL
address
M8VbLzfh2hJux5dCNjBG7zj6Vd5UaNtGcZ
transaction
997c64ae60270b383833851e65a4b791be0bd73832764217ce11802174a2674d
spent
true